* {
	box-sizing: border-box;
	padding: 0;
	margin: 0;
}
html {
	font-size: 18px;
	font-size: calc(9px + 0.520835vw);
}
header {
	position: -webkit-sticky; 
	position: sticky;
	top: 0;
	z-index: 99;
}
h1, h2, h3, h4, h5, h6 {
	
}
h1, h2, h3, h4, h5, h6, p {
	margin-block-start: 0em;
	margin-block-end: 0em;
	margin-inline-start: 0px;
	margin-inline-end: 0px;
}
a {
	display: -webkit-inline-flex;
	display: inline-flex;
}

.background-glass {
    background: rgba(255, 255, 255, 0.25);
    backdrop-filter: blur(5px);
    -webkit-backdrop-filter: blur(5px);
}

.elementor-widget .elementor-icon-list-item .elementor-icon-list-icon+.elementor-icon-list-text {
	padding-inline-start: 0px;
}
.elementor-widget .elementor-icon-list-item .elementor-icon-list-icon i {
    font-size: var(--e-icon-list-icon-size);
    width: auto;
    line-height: inherit;
}